Why Buyers Choose Sun Prairie

Sun Prairie continues to attract buyers because it offers a combination of established neighborhoods, newer developments, parks, recreation, schools, shopping, restaurants and convenient access to Madison and the surrounding area.

The City of Sun Prairie describes the community as having a high quality of life, a historic downtown, strong parks and recreation programs and a wide variety of housing options.

Because Sun Prairie includes so many different neighborhoods and styles of housing, buyers may be searching for very different things. Some want a newer home near parks and schools. Others prefer an established neighborhood with mature trees. Buyers may also be looking for a condominium, ranch home, larger two-story property, rural setting or something close to downtown.

Understanding which buyers are most likely to be interested in your particular home is an important part of creating the right selling strategy.

Start With a Sun Prairie Home Value Review

Online home-value estimates can be a useful starting point, but they do not know the complete story of your property.

An online algorithm may not fully account for:

  • Your home’s condition and recent improvements
  • The quality of the lot or backyard
  • Finished basement space
  • Updated kitchens and bathrooms
  • Garage size
  • Neighborhood location
  • School boundaries
  • Competing homes currently on the market
  • Differences between nearby developments
  • Features that are difficult to measure online

A local real estate professional can compare your home with recent sales, active competition and properties that are currently under contract. Your timeline and priorities should also be considered when deciding on a listing price.

Pricing is not simply about choosing the highest possible number. The goal is to position your home where qualified buyers will see its value and feel motivated to schedule a showing. The National Association of REALTORS® notes that pricing strategy can affect the size of the buyer pool reached by a listing.

Prepare Your Home Before It Reaches the Market

You do not necessarily need to complete a major renovation before selling your home. In many cases, smaller improvements can make a meaningful difference.

Before listing, we can help you determine which projects are worth completing and which ones are unlikely to produce a sufficient return.

Common preparations may include:

  • Decluttering and removing excess furniture
  • Completing minor repairs
  • Touching up paint
  • Improving landscaping and curb appeal
  • Deep cleaning the home
  • Replacing burned-out lightbulbs
  • Organizing closets and storage areas
  • Making rooms feel bright and inviting
  • Addressing noticeable maintenance concerns

The goal is not to make your home look untouched or impersonal. The goal is to help buyers comfortably imagine themselves living there.

Preparing a home before it is listed can also make the selling process smoother and help reduce preventable surprises later in the transaction.

Tell the Story of the Home

A successful listing should do more than list the number of bedrooms, bathrooms and square feet.

Buyers also want to understand how the home feels and how it could fit their lifestyle.

Does the kitchen create a natural gathering place? Is the backyard ideal for entertaining? Is there a quiet home office? Does the finished basement provide space for movie nights, exercise equipment or visiting guests? Is the property close to a favorite Sun Prairie park, restaurant or neighborhood amenity?

These details help buyers connect emotionally with the property.

Understand Your Local Competition

Your home does not compete equally with every property in Sun Prairie. It primarily competes with homes that appeal to a similar buyer.

A buyer considering your home may also be comparing it with properties that have a similar location, price, size, age, condition or school district. That competition can change from week to week as new homes enter the market, prices are adjusted and other properties receive accepted offers.

We monitor that activity throughout the listing period.

If showing activity or buyer feedback is different from what we expected, we will discuss what the market may be telling us. Sometimes the solution is additional promotion. In other situations, presentation, condition or pricing may need to be reconsidered.

Review More Than the Offer Price

Receiving an offer is exciting, but the highest price is not automatically the strongest offer.

Important terms may include:

  • Financing type
  • Down payment
  • Earnest money
  • Inspection contingency
  • Appraisal contingency
  • Closing date
  • Seller credits
  • Home-sale contingency
  • Personal property requests
  • Buyer flexibility
  • Overall likelihood of reaching closing

We will explain the complete offer, answer your questions and help you evaluate the potential benefits and risks.
